ILTA is one of my favorite conferences in our industry. It is spread out over 5 days so there is plenty of time to network and catch up with old friends. It isn’t nearly as chaotic as LegalTech New York and the sessions tend to move the industry forward with more thought leadership. D4 has 6 team members attending this year, along with a Silver sponsorship and we look forward to a great conference.
There are over 200 speakers and sessions this year and ILTA expects more than 3,000 attendees. It is a good idea to map out what you want to see and who you want to connect with in advance. But if you’re here and didn’t get a chance to plan ahead, no worries, just download the mobile ILTA Events app so you can make your plans on the fly.
